Volume | V.3 |
Number | — (unassigned; ID 78111) |
Province | Egypt |
Region | Egypt |
City | Alexandria |
Reign | Caracalla |
Person (obv.) | Caracalla (Augustus) |
Issue | Year 22 |
Dating | AD 213/14 |
Obverse inscription | [ΑΥΤ Κ] Μ ΑΥΡ ϹΕ ΑΝΤωΝ[ΙΝΟϹ Π Μ ΒΡΕ Μ Ε]Υ Ϲ[ΕΒ] |
Edition | Αὐτ(οκράτωρ) Κ(αῖσαρ) Μ(ᾶρκος) Αὐρ(ήλιος) Σε(ουῆρος) Ἀντωνῖνος Π(αρθικὸς) Μ(έγιστος) Βρε(ττανικὸς) Μ(έγιστος) Εὐ(σεβὴς) Σεβ(αστός) |
Translation | Emperor Caesar Marcus Aurelius Severus Antoninus Parthicus Greatest Britannicus Greatest Pious Augustus |
Obverse design | laureate head of Caracalla, right |
Reverse inscription | L ΚΒ |
Edition | (ἔτους) κβʹ |
Translation | of year 22 |
Reverse design | Sarapis standing facing, his right hand raised, and holding sceptre with his left; to left, lighted altar |
Metal | copper-based alloy |
Average diameter | 33 mm |
Average weight | 15.26 g |
Axis | 12 |
Reference | D 4072; Emmett 2849 |
Specimens | 2 (0 in the core collections) |
